Output 81460eb56950e5a064fd0a189d68d4e2f51d624427c042c85fa7316dba76ce97:2

value
18280973
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 ded9f0b8fb817b13190aade6baa5c31e28b3c3fa OP_EQUALVERIFY OP_CHECKSIG
address
1MKL6M34AvfnhhCSeENtxEQ7JbdrgVp8hm
transaction
81460eb56950e5a064fd0a189d68d4e2f51d624427c042c85fa7316dba76ce97
spent
true